The Historian at the State Historical Society will collect oral histories, produce publications, and conduct presentations on the history and culture of Missouri. You will plan, conduct, transcribe, edit, and make interviews available, and develop content for the Missouri Historical Review, Encyclopedia, and exhibits.
Responsibilities include media outreach, teaching workshops, and transcribing collections to digital formats, with occasional travel.
